The Biggest Pros and Cons

The 1980 Pearson 40 is a classic cruiser-racer sailboat known for its solid construction and balanced sailing performance. Here are some of the key pros and cons of this model:

Pros

Sturdy Construction: Built with a robust fiberglass hull and solid deck, the Pearson 40 offers durability and longevity.

Spacious Interior: Designed for comfortable cruising, it provides ample cabin space with good headroom and thoughtful layout for extended trips.

Balanced Sailing Performance: With a well-designed keel and sail plan, the Pearson 40 delivers stable and efficient sailing, suitable for both racing and cruising.

Good Storage: Generous storage compartments make it practical for long voyages.

Classic Aesthetics: Timeless design appeals to enthusiasts of traditional sailboats.

Cons

Older Design: As a boat from 1980, some design elements and onboard systems may feel dated compared to modern yachts.

Maintenance Needs: Older fiberglass boats like the Pearson 40 may require regular upkeep to address issues such as gelcoat wear or rigging inspection.

Heavier Displacement: Compared to newer performance cruisers, it can be heavier, which might impact light wind performance.

Limited Modern Amenities: The standard equipment and onboard technology may lack some of the conveniences found in contemporary sailboats.
